Hi All

I'm currently trying to do the conference to prem challenge as York. With no transfer budget at all I was under the impression that scouting would be the way forward. I keep sending the lad out to find me a brazilian wonderkid but he keeps coming back with no results. I'm now fourth in D1 after three seasons and during the course of all three seasons my scout hasn't come back with a single player? I realise I may not be able to attract superb players but surely I could attract someone so why does he keep coming back with no one??

Any ideas??

A scout will only return with players who he believes are viable signings for your club, ie. someone who will get a work permit and also be interested in the move.

I'm guessing that there simply aren't any Brazillians who want to move to an English lower league side ...

I've tuned scouting for the next version so they will return more 'borderline' players and thus you'll find more people through them.

PS> This 'filtering' is required - if you think about it otherwise you'd have the scout returning big name stars who you have no hope of signing ...

So would you reccomend scouting different regions or simply wait till I'm in a higher league? </div></BLOCKQUOTE>

If you're a smaller club then I'd suggest scouting domestically (which includes Ireland, Wales and Scotland if you're an English club) initially - simply because you won't be able to persuade that many foreign players to move to England to join you.

PS> Obviously over time as your club (hopefully) gets a bigger reputation you can branch out and look abroad as you'd expect ..

Scouting has always been at best questionable in the game but setting your sights lower is a good start. scouting specific competitions is also better than general seartches. Scout in your own league and the one below you and equivalent leagues close to you.
